Transaction 665800dad7313e6753a91de077dbc1e775a65b10cdc3ab84cf451e104113bb9e
1 Input
1 Output
-
665800dad7313e6753a91de077dbc1e775a65b10cdc3ab84cf451e104113bb9e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7b95c1460faeaadaa8bbe5150c1a0dac7fce03fb63f86ad33b00e56fd0a244e7
- address
- bc1p0w2uz3s0464d429mu52scxsd43luuqlmv0ux45emqrjkl59zgnnsaldsyr